Preparing Effectively for PSLE

The Primary School Leaving Examination (PSLE) is a major academic milestone. Preparing for it requires familiarity with exam formats, structured answering techniques, and strong time management skills.

Assessment books for upper primary levels often include mock papers that simulate real exam conditions. These practice papers allow students to experience timed assessments before the actual examination, helping them build both stamina and strategy.

Effective PSLE preparation supports students in:

  • Managing time efficiently during full-length papers
  • Understanding mark allocation and question structure
  • Identifying weak topics through self-assessment
  • Refining answering techniques for higher scores

When preparation includes realistic exam practice, students approach PSLE with greater confidence and clarity.

Developing Strong Answer Presentation Skills

Scoring well in primary examinations requires clear and structured presentation. In subjects like Mathematics and Science, marks are awarded not only for correct answers but also for proper workings and explanations.

Assessment books that include model answers teach students how to structure responses logically. Learning how to present answers neatly and concisely improves overall scoring potential.

Clear presentation skills help students reduce careless errors and communicate their understanding effectively. Over time, this attention to detail contributes significantly to stronger academic performance.
